Baseado na Teoria Solunar (John Alden Knight): peixes e animais silvestres tendem a se alimentar mais nos períodos em que a lua está a pino ou no fundo (maiores) e no nascer/poente da lua (menores). A pontuação considera a fase lunar e o cruzamento dos períodos maiores com a maré cheia local.

📘 About Palermo Tide Forecast
In the northern hemisphere, the coastal area of Palermo (Italy) is positioned at coordinates 38.12° N and 13.37° E. Its tidal pattern is semi-diurnal (two high and two low tides per day), with a mean tidal range of 0.2m and spring tides reaching up to 0.3m. Beaches here have very narrow intertidal zones, with only a few metres between high and low water marks. Bathers and stand-up paddlers can choose between morning and afternoon high tides for calm-water conditions. This shoreline is subject to seasonal wind and pressure variations that can affect tide height by up to 0.3m during extreme events.
